You're getting the OOM killer because your database server wants more memory than you have RAM.

The best way to work around this problem is to set up swap. A swap area is a contiguous area on disk (either a file or a whole disk partition) used to store allocated but not currently in-use pages (4KB). swap will keep the OOM killer quiet.
How much swap? 1 x RAM is a minimum, but if 4 x RAM doesn't do it for you, re-ananlze your database use. YMMV
Read man free mkswap swapon fstab

If your entire server has 2G of ram, then setting the innodb buffer pool size to 2147483648 will exceed the capacity of the server as the kernel and other MariaDB components need RAM too.

Recommend keeping 1G as the size, and maybe less depending on what else is running on the server.

Also set innodb_flush_method=fsync to maximise the use of filesystem cache (unused memory).
